Dinner

Dinner typically refers to the main meal of the day, which is usually eaten in the evening. It can vary in size and style depending on cultural, regional, and individual preferences. Dinner may consist of several courses, including appetizers, a main course, side dishes, and sometimes dessert. The specific foods served for dinner can vary widely, ranging from simple dishes to elaborate recipes, and might include meat, seafood, vegetables, grains, and more. In many cultures, dinner is also a time for family and friends to gather, share stories, and enjoy each other's company.
